The Houston Rockets (22–13) travel to Golden 1 Center to face the Sacramento Kings (8–30) on Sunday night. Houston is looking to snap a three-game road losing streak, while Sacramento continues to struggle near the bottom of the standings. The Rockets are listed as heavy 13-point favorites, with the total set at 223.5. Houston has been favored in 33 games this season, winning 21, while Sacramento has managed just six wins in 35 games as underdogs.
Both teams trend toward high-scoring contests, combining to average 228.3 points per game, above the posted total. Houston is without Fred VanVleet and Alperen Sengun, while Sacramento misses Keegan Murray and Domantas Sabonis. Our best bet for Rockets vs Kings is Rockets -13 (-110) against the spread.
Houston ranks 9th in scoring (118.5 PPG) and 2nd in defense (110.7 allowed), while Sacramento averages just 109.8 points per game. The Kings have been poor ATS at home (5–12–1), and Houston has covered in four of five games when favored by 13 or more.
Kevin Durant and Amen Thompson lead a balanced Rockets attack, while Sacramento struggles without Sabonis and Murray. Given the matchup, pace and current spread, we’re backing Houston to cover -13 and expect them to win comfortably.
